ABAD HOTELS & RESORTS – Hotels in India
ABAD HOTELS & RESORTS Corporate Office: Abad Hotels, M.G Road, Cochin-682 035 Contact: +91 48 4414 4000, +91 48 4237[…]
Read moreABAD HOTELS & RESORTS Corporate Office: Abad Hotels, M.G Road, Cochin-682 035 Contact: +91 48 4414 4000, +91 48 4237[…]
Read more